Shopifyエンジニアに未経験からなるには?2026年の需要と転職成功ロードマップ
「未経験からでもShopifyエンジニアになれるの?」「2026年の市場ってどうなっているんだろう?」
そう考えているあなたへ。Eコマース市場の拡大に伴い、Shopifyエンジニアの需要は年々高まっています。特に2026年現在、その勢いは加速しており、未経験からでも挑戦しやすい環境が整いつつあります。
この記事では、Shopifyエンジニアの魅力から、未経験から転職を成功させるための具体的なロードマップ、必要なスキル、学習方法、そして気になる年収まで、転職図鑑が徹底解説します。公的統計データに基づいた信頼性の高い情報と、具体的な成功事例を交えながら、あなたのキャリアチェンジを力強くサポートします。
Shopifyエンジニアとは?その魅力と将来性
【Shopifyエンジニアについてより詳しく知る】Shopifyエンジニアは、世界中で利用されているECプラットフォーム「Shopify」を使って、オンラインストアの構築、カスタマイズ、機能追加、運用保守を行う専門家です。単にストアを作るだけでなく、クライアントのビジネス課題を解決し、売上向上に貢献する重要な役割を担います。
1. 拡大するEC市場とShopifyの存在感
経済産業省の「電子商取引に関する市場調査」によると、日本国内のBtoC-EC(消費者向け電子商取引)市場規模は年々拡大を続けており、2022年には22.7兆円に達しています。この成長は今後も続くと見込まれており、ECサイト構築・運用を支えるShopifyエンジニアの需要は非常に高い状態が続くでしょう。
Shopifyは、その使いやすさと拡張性の高さから、個人事業主から大企業まで幅広く利用されており、ECプラットフォームの中でも特に存在感を増しています。そのため、Shopifyを扱えるエンジニアは、今後も市場から強く求められる人材であり続けると言えます。
2. 未経験からでも挑戦しやすい理由
Shopifyは、プログラミング知識がなくても基本的なストア構築ができるように設計されています。しかし、より高度なカスタマイズや機能開発には、Liquid(Shopify独自のテンプレート言語)、HTML、CSS、JavaScriptなどの知識が必要です。これらのスキルは、Web開発の基礎と共通する部分が多く、体系的に学習すれば未経験からでも習得しやすいのが特徴です。
また、Shopifyには豊富な公式ドキュメントやコミュニティがあり、学習リソースが充実しています。未経験者向けの学習コンテンツも多く、独学でも着実にスキルを身につけることが可能です。
未経験からShopifyエンジニアになるためのロードマップ
【Shopifyエンジニアについてより詳しく知る】未経験からShopifyエンジニアを目指すには、計画的な学習と実践が不可欠です。ここでは、具体的なステップを紹介します。
ステップ1: Web開発の基礎を習得する
Shopifyエンジニアになるために、まずWeb開発の基礎を固めましょう。具体的には以下のスキルが必須です。
- HTML/CSS: Webページの構造とデザインを記述するための言語。基本的なレイアウト作成やスタイリングができるレベルを目指します。
- JavaScript: Webページに動きやインタラクティブな要素を追加するための言語。DOM操作やイベント処理の基礎を理解しましょう。
- Liquid: Shopify独自のテンプレート言語。Shopifyテーマのカスタマイズには必須です。HTML/CSSの知識があれば比較的スムーズに習得できます。
これらのスキルは、プログラミングスクールやオンライン学習プラットフォーム(Udemy, Progate, ドットインストールなど)で効率的に学べます。まずは基礎文法を理解し、簡単なWebページを作成できるレベルを目指しましょう。
ステップ2: Shopifyの基本操作とテーマ開発を学ぶ
Web開発の基礎が身についたら、いよいよShopifyに特化した学習に入ります。
- Shopifyストアの基本操作: 管理画面の使い方、商品登録、コレクション作成、決済設定など、基本的なストア運営方法を理解します。開発者アカウントを作成し、実際に触ってみるのが一番の近道です。
- Shopifyテーマ開発: 公式テーマ(Dawnなど)をベースに、Liquidを使ってカスタマイズする方法を学びます。セクション、ブロック、スニペットなどの概念を理解し、既存テーマの改修や新規テーマの構築に挑戦してみましょう。
- Shopify CLI: コマンドラインツールを使ってテーマ開発を効率化する方法を習得します。
ステップ3: ポートフォリオを作成する
未経験からの転職において、ポートフォリオはあなたのスキルを証明する最も重要なツールです。以下の内容を盛り込んだポートフォリオを作成しましょう。
- オリジナルShopifyストアの構築: 自分でテーマをカスタマイズした架空のストアを構築し、公開します。デザインだけでなく、機能面(商品ページ、カート、決済フローなど)も意識して作り込みましょう。
- 既存テーマのカスタマイズ事例: 無料テーマをダウンロードし、特定の機能追加やデザイン変更を行った事例を掲載します。Before/Afterを示すとより効果的です。
- GitHubでのコード公開: 作成したコードはGitHubで公開し、採用担当者がコード品質を確認できるようにします。
ステップ4: 転職活動を開始する
ポートフォリオが完成したら、いよいよ転職活動です。転職エージェントの活用や、求人サイトでの情報収集、企業への直接応募など、様々な方法でアプローチしましょう。
- 履歴書・職務経歴書: 未経験の場合、これまでの職務経験で培った課題解決能力や学習意欲をアピールしましょう。Shopifyエンジニアとしてのスキルはポートフォリオで補完します。
- 面接対策: なぜShopifyエンジニアになりたいのか、どのように学習してきたのか、将来のキャリアプランなど、明確に答えられるように準備します。技術的な質問にも対応できるよう、基礎知識を再確認しておきましょう。
Shopifyエンジニアの年収とキャリアパス
【Shopifyエンジニアについてより詳しく知る】Shopifyエンジニアは、その専門性の高さから比較的高い年収が期待できます。未経験からのスタートでも、経験を積むことで着実に年収アップが見込めるでしょう。
未経験・ジュニアクラスの年収
未経験からShopifyエンジニアとしてスタートする場合、初年度の年収は300万円〜450万円程度が目安となることが多いです。これは、厚生労働省の「令和4年賃金構造基本統計調査」における「情報通信業」の平均賃金(月額約37万円、年間約444万円)と比較しても、十分に競争力のある水準と言えます。
もちろん、企業規模や地域、個人のスキルレベルによって幅はありますが、Web開発の基礎がしっかり身についていれば、このレンジでのスタートは十分に可能です。
経験者・シニアクラスの年収
経験を3〜5年以上積んだShopifyエンジニアであれば、年収500万円〜800万円、さらに上級のリードエンジニアやテックリード、フリーランスとして独立した場合は800万円以上も十分に狙えます。特に、クライアントのビジネス成長に貢献できる提案力や、大規模プロジェクトをマネジメントできるスキルがあれば、市場価値はさらに高まります。
キャリアパスの多様性
Shopifyエンジニアとしてのキャリアパスは多岐にわたります。
- 受託開発企業: 複数のクライアントのECサイト構築・カスタマイズを担当。
- 事業会社: 自社ECサイトの専任エンジニアとして、機能改善や運用に深く携わる。
- フリーランス: 自身のスキルを活かして独立し、プロジェクトごとに契約。
- コンサルタント: Shopifyの知見を活かし、EC戦略の立案や技術選定を支援。
あなたの興味や志向に合わせて、様々なキャリアを築くことが可能です。
未経験からShopifyエンジニアになったAさんの事例
【Shopifyエンジニアについてより詳しく知る】ここで、実際に未経験からShopifyエンジニアに転身したAさんの事例をご紹介しましょう。
Aさん(32歳・元営業職)は、アパレル業界で約8年間営業として働いていました。ECサイトの売上向上に貢献したいという思いから、Web開発に興味を持ち始めました。当初は独学でHTML/CSSを学び始めましたが、体系的な学習の必要性を感じ、プログラミングスクールに通うことを決意。約半年間、仕事と両立しながらWeb開発の基礎とShopifyテーマ開発を徹底的に学習しました。
スクール卒業後、Aさんは自身の学習成果をまとめたポートフォリオサイトを作成。架空のアパレルECサイトをShopifyで構築し、商品の詳細ページやカート機能、決済フローまで実装しました。特にこだわったのは、顧客体験を向上させるためのUI/UXデザインでした。
転職活動では、当初は書類選考で苦戦することもあったものの、ポートフォリオを見せることで「未経験とは思えない完成度」と評価されることが増えました。最終的に、Shopify専門の受託開発を行う企業から内定を獲得。現在は、ジュニアShopifyエンジニアとして、複数のクライアントのECサイト構築・カスタマイズ案件に携わっています。「営業時代に培ったヒアリング力や提案力が、お客様の要望を汲み取る上で役立っています」と語るAさん。未経験からの挑戦でしたが、着実にキャリアを築いています。
Shopifyエンジニアに求められるスキルとマインドセット
【Shopifyエンジニアについてより詳しく知る】技術スキルはもちろん重要ですが、それ以外にもShopifyエンジニアとして成功するために必要な要素があります。
1. 技術スキル
- Web開発の基礎: HTML, CSS, JavaScript (ES6以降)
- Liquid: Shopifyテーマ開発の必須言語
- Git/GitHub: バージョン管理システム
- Shopify CLI: 開発効率化ツール
- API連携の基礎: 外部サービスとの連携知識
- UI/UXの基礎知識: ユーザーにとって使いやすいデザインの理解
2. ビジネススキル・マインドセット
- 学習意欲: 新しい技術やShopifyのアップデートに常に対応できる探求心
- 問題解決能力: クライアントの課題を技術で解決する力
- コミュニケーション能力: クライアントやチームメンバーと円滑に連携する力
- 論理的思考力: 複雑な要件を整理し、効率的な解決策を導き出す力
- Eコマースへの理解: ECビジネスの仕組みやトレンドへの関心
これらのスキルとマインドセットを意識して学習・業務に取り組むことで、Shopifyエンジニアとして大きく成長できるでしょう。
2026年、Shopifyエンジニアとして成功するためのヒント
2026年、Shopifyエンジニアとして市場価値を高め、成功するためには、以下の点に注目しましょう。
1. 最新のShopify機能とエコシステムを常にキャッチアップ
Shopifyは常に進化しており、新しい機能やAPIが頻繁にリリースされます。例えば、Headless Commerceのトレンドや、Shopify Functions、Hydrogenなどの最新技術への理解は、今後のキャリアにおいて大きな強みとなります。公式ブログや開発者ドキュメントを定期的にチェックし、常に最新情報をキャッチアップする習慣をつけましょう。
2. マーケティング・ビジネス視点を持つ
単に「コードを書ける」だけでなく、「どうすればクライアントの売上が上がるか」「顧客体験が向上するか」というビジネス視点を持つことが重要です。SEO、Web広告、SNSマーケティングなど、ECサイト運営に関わる幅広い知識を身につけることで、より付加価値の高い提案ができるエンジニアになれます。
3. コミュニティへの参加と情報交換
Shopify開発者コミュニティやWebエンジニアコミュニティに積極的に参加しましょう。他のエンジニアとの情報交換や、困ったときの助け合いは、学習のモチベーション維持やスキルアップに繋がります。オンライン・オフライン問わず、積極的に交流の場を求めることが、あなたの成長を加速させます。
まとめ:未経験からShopifyエンジニアへの道は開かれている
2026年、未経験からShopifyエンジニアを目指すことは、決して夢ではありません。EC市場の成長とShopifyの需要拡大により、学習意欲と適切なロードマップがあれば、誰にでもチャンスがあります。
Web開発の基礎から着実にスキルを身につけ、質の高いポートフォリオを作成し、ビジネス視点を持って学習に取り組むことで、あなたのキャリアチェンジは必ず成功するでしょう。この記事が、あなたのShopifyエンジニアへの第一歩を力強く後押しできれば幸いです。
